rubbing with a liquid laundry detergent or paste of granular laundry detergent and water. Launder using chlorine bleach, if safe for fabric. If not, use a sodium perborate or oxygen bleach. Soak in a solution of 1 quart warm water, 1/2 teaspoon detergent and 1 tablespoon white vinegar for 15 minutes.
Always consult the Material Safety Data Sheet of any substance if you are unsure about handling. In the case of isopropyl alcohol and the 70% aqueous solution, unless you can still smell it on the clothing or other fabric it should be fine.
Apply rubbing alcohol, hair spray, or hand sanitizer to dilute the stain, making it easier to remove during the wash. These solvents help tackle most types of ink stains but remember to test the stained garment for colorfastness first as they can also attack fabric dyes and cause further damage.
Rubbing alcohol can be effective for cleaning finished wood surfaces, particularly for removing grease, grime, or stubborn stains. Dilute rubbing alcohol with water in a 1:1 ratio to avoid damaging the wood finish, then apply it to a clean cloth and gently wipe the surface in a circular motion.
Rubbing alcohol is a diluted form of isopropyl alcohol. Sometimes, it also contains other ingredients, such as wintergreen essential oil. While the concentration of isopropyl alcohol is 100%, the concentration of many brands of rubbing alcohol is 70%.
It leaves no residue and evaporates quickly relative to water. It is low toxicity compared to alternative solvents and is similarly relatively environmentally benign, being ozone safe with excellent green solvent scores.
Isopropyl alcohol is colorless and therefore doesnt stain fabric. It may have partially dissolved the dye already present in the fabric and caused to to migrate along with the alcohol as it spread by capillary action, in which case you probably see a lighter area surrounded by a darker ring.
If its a small stain, place a paper towel under the stain and use an eyedropper to apply rubbing alcohol onto the stain. For a larger spot, pour the alcohol into a small dish, immerse the stained area and soak for 15 minutes.
